Transaction ed28d4e6988237d4256df489a1b3d8d11ee64bee1b9533995d5df1b1cf836a16

1 Input
1 Outputs
  • ed28d4e6988237d4256df489a1b3d8d11ee64bee1b9533995d5df1b1cf836a16:0
  • value  3676229
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G